โมดูลแสดงผล LED นี้ได้รับการออกแบบมาสำหรับการใช้งานในสภาพแวดล้อมใต้น้ำ โดยช่วยให้สามารถมองเห็นค่าพารามิเตอร์ทางไฟฟ้าของระบบได้ทันที โมดูลดังกล่าวเชื่อมต่อกับบอร์ดขับสัญญาณ (Driver Board) ของ Blu-Sub ที่เหมาะสมเพื่อรับสัญญาณแบบเรียลไทม์ ทำให้สามารถติดตามประสิทธิภาพการทำงานของระบบไฟฟ้าในยาน ROV ภายในตู้ควบคุม หรือในระบบที่เชื่อมต่อด้วยสายเคเบิล (tethered setups) ได้อย่างต่อเนื่อง
ด้วยรูปแบบและโครงสร้างการห่อหุ้ม โมดูลนี้จึงเหมาะอย่างยิ่งสำหรับการใช้งานแบบฝังตัว (embedded applications) ที่ต้องการความสามารถในการมองเห็นข้อมูลผ่านส่วนแสดงผลที่ได้รับการซีลปิดผนึกอย่างมิดชิด อุปกรณ์นี้ได้รับการออกแบบมาให้สามารถติดตั้งได้ทั้งภายในตู้หรือบนแผงควบคุมที่เปิดโล่ง และรองรับการเชื่อมต่อเข้ากับระบบตรวจสอบข้อมูลที่ครอบคลุมยิ่งขึ้นผ่านอินเทอร์เฟซรับสัญญาณ
| สินค้า | จอแสดงผล LED แบบ 7 ส่วน |
|---|---|
| ความลึกที่ทนต่อแรงดัน | 1,000 เมตร / 3,281 ฟุต |
| ขนาดเกลียว | M10×1 |
| ตัวเลขที่แสดง | 1 |
| สีที่แสดงผล | เหลือง / แดง |
| ขนาดหน้าจอ | 0.28 นิ้ว |
| วัสดุหัวเจาะทะลุ | อะลูมิเนียมชุบอโนไดซ์ |
| ความยาวสายไฟ | ~200 มม. |
| ข้อกำหนดอินเทอร์เฟซ | 1.25 มม. - 8 พิน |
| ช่วงแรงดันไฟฟ้าของ LED | 1.7–2.4 V |
| กระแสไฟฟ้าในทิศทางไปข้างหน้า | 20 มิลลิแอมป์ |
| กระแสพัลส์ทิศทางไปข้างหน้า | 60 มิลลิแอมป์ |
| แรงดันย้อนกลับ | 5 โวลต์ |
| ขั้วของ LED | คอมมอนแอโนด |
| ความสว่าง | สีเหลือง: 105 mcd; สีแดง: 22 mcd |
| อุณหภูมิขณะทำงาน | -10 ถึง 60 °C |
| ขนาดของบอร์ดไดรเวอร์ | 20 × 55 มม. |
| แรงดันไฟฟ้าของบอร์ดขับ | 5 โวลต์ |
| กระแสไฟฟ้าของบอร์ดขับ | 0.2 A (สูงสุด) |
| อินเทอร์เฟซของบอร์ดขับเคลื่อน | 4 |
| วิธีการสื่อสาร | USART (TTL) |
| ขนาดรูเจาะผ่านผนังที่แนะนำ (A) | Ø10.1 ± 0.1 มม. |
| ความหนาของฝาปิดช่อง (B) | 13 มม. |
| ช่วงอุณหภูมิพื้นผิว (C) | 20 มม. |
ภาพวาดแสดงขนาดของทั้งจอแสดงผล LED แบบ 7-segment และบอร์ดขับสัญญาณมีระบุไว้ด้านล่างนี้เพื่อใช้เป็นข้อมูลอ้างอิง
คำจำกัดความของอินเทอร์เฟซ:
บอร์ดขับ Digital Tube นี้สามารถตั้งค่าพารามิเตอร์และควบคุมการแสดงผลของ Digital Tube แบบ 7-Segment (ชนิด Common Anode) ขนาด 1 ถึง 4 หลักได้ โดยการส่งข้อมูลแบบข้อความ (string) ผ่านพอร์ตอนุกรม (Serial Port) นอกจากนี้ยังสามารถปรับระดับความสว่างได้ 8 ระดับ โดยในแต่ละหลักจะแสดงผลได้ในช่วงค่า 0–9 และ A–F หากค่าที่ส่งมาอยู่นอกเหนือจากช่วงดังกล่าว ระบบจะไม่แสดงผล
| ป้าย | สีของสายไฟ | ชื่อ | คำอธิบายฟังก์ชัน |
| 1 | สีดำ | - | ขั้วลบของแหล่งจ่ายไฟ |
| 2 | สีเขียว | ใบสั่งยา | การส่งข้อมูลผ่านพอร์ตซีเรียล (RXD) |
| 3 | สีขาว | เท็กซัส | การรับข้อมูลผ่านพอร์ตซีเรียล (TXD) |
| 4 | สีแดง | + | ขั้วบวกของแหล่งจ่ายไฟ (5V DC) |
การเชื่อมต่อระหว่างบอร์ดขับ Digital Tube กับตัวควบคุมภายนอก:
| ตัวควบคุมภายนอก | บอร์ดขับ Digital Tube |
| 5 โวลต์ | 5 โวลต์ |
| RXD | TXD |
| TXD | RXD |
| GND | GND |
พารามิเตอร์ของพอร์ตอนุกรม:
| อินเทอร์เฟซการสื่อสาร | TTL |
| อัตราโบด์ | ค่าเริ่มต้น 115200 bps ปรับเปลี่ยนได้ |
| ข้อมูลย่อย | 8 |
| สต็อปบิต | 1 |
| บิตพาริตี | ไม่มี |
ตารางการกำหนดค่าคำสั่งพารามิเตอร์:
| คำสั่งแบบอนุกรม | รายละเอียด | ค่าเริ่มต้น | หมายเหตุ | เลขฐานสิบหกที่สอดคล้องกัน |
| !Bx | กำหนดค่า Baud Rate สำหรับการสื่อสารแบบอนุกรมของเซ็นเซอร์ | 0x07 | x คือค่า baud rate ที่ตั้งไว้ | 21 42 x 0D 0A |
| !Lx | ตั้งค่าความสว่างของจอแสดงผลแบบดิจิทัลทิวบ์ | 0x08 | x คือระดับความสว่างของหน้าจอ | 21 4C x 0D 0A |
| ขอบคุณ! | กำหนดค่าสถานะของตัวบ่งชี้บนอุปกรณ์ | 0x02 | x คือสถานะการแสดงผล | 21 54 x 0D 0A |
| !Sxxxx | คำสั่งกำหนดค่าการแสดงผลแบบดิจิทัลทูบ | ไม่มี | xxxx คือค่าที่แสดงบนจอแสดงผลแบบดิจิทัลทูบ | 21 53 xxxx 0D 0A |
| !R | รีเซ็ตบอร์ดขับ Digital Tube | ไม่มี | \ | 21 52 0D 0A |
| !r | คืนค่าการตั้งค่าเริ่มต้นทั้งหมด | ไม่มี | \ | 21 72 0D 0A |
พารามิเตอร์ที่ตั้งค่าไว้บนบอร์ดขับ Digital Tube จะถูกบันทึกไว้ และข้อมูลการตั้งค่าจะยังคงมีผลแม้หลังจากปิดและเปิดเครื่องใหม่
ตาราง Baud Rate:
| อัตราโบด์ | ค่า (x) |
| 2400 | 0 |
| 4800 | 1 |
| 9600 | 2 |
| 14400 | 3 |
| 19200 | 4 |
| 38400 | 5 |
| 57600 | 6 |
| 115200 | 7 |
| อื่นๆ | 115200 |
ตัวอย่าง:
ตั้งค่า Baud rate ของพอร์ตอนุกรมเป็น 115200: !B7\r\n
เลขฐานสิบหกที่ตรงกัน: 21 42 37 0D 0A
ตารางความสว่างหน้าจอ:
| ระดับความสว่าง | ค่า (x) |
| ความสว่าง 1 | 1 |
| ความสว่าง 2 | 2 |
| ความสว่าง 3 | 3 |
| ความสว่าง 4 | 4 |
| ความสว่าง 5 | 5 |
| ความสว่าง 6 | 6 |
| ความสว่าง 7 | 7 |
| ความสว่าง 8 | 8 |
| ความสว่างสูงสุด | อื่นๆ |
ตัวอย่าง:
ตั้งค่าความสว่างเป็นระดับ 8: !L8
เลขฐานสิบหกที่สอดคล้องกัน: 21 4C 38 0D 0A
คำสั่งกำหนดค่าสถานะตัวบ่งชี้บนบอร์ด:
ขอบคุณ!
| สถานะ | ค่า (x) |
| ปิดอยู่ตลอดเวลา | 0 |
| เปิดใช้งานตลอดเวลา | 1 |
| การกะพริบตา | 2 |
ตัวอย่าง:
ตั้งค่าตัวบ่งชี้เป็นปิด: !T0\r\n
เลขฐานสิบหกที่ตรงกัน: 21 54 30 0D 0A
คำสั่งกำหนดค่าการแสดงผลแบบ Digital Tube:
!Sxxxx
xxxx คือเนื้อหาที่แสดงบนจอแสดงผลแบบดิจิทัลทูบ
ตัวอย่าง:
แสดงผล “AB12” บนหลอดแสดงผลแบบดิจิทัล: !SAB12\r\n
เลขฐานสิบหกที่ตรงกัน: 21 53 41 42 31 32 0D 0A
คำจำกัดความของขาใช้งานจอแสดงผล LED แบบ 7-Segment:
| รหัส PIN | ชื่อพิน |
| 1 | COM |
| 2 | G |
| 3 | F |
| 4 | E |
| 5 | D |
| 6 | C |
| 7 | B |
| 8 | A |
มันสามารถแสดงระดับพลังงานแบตเตอรี่ได้โดยตรงหรือไม่ และมีวิธีการใช้งานเพื่อแสดงระดับพลังงานแบตเตอรี่อย่างไร
ไม่สามารถแสดงผลได้โดยตรง จำเป็นต้องเพิ่มวงจรสำหรับแรงดันไฟฟ้าที่จะวัดและบอร์ดไดรเวอร์สำหรับจอแสดงผลแบบ 7-segment
สามารถต่อสายไฟให้ยาวขึ้นได้หรือไม่
สายไฟไม่ควรยาวเกินไป แต่สามารถขยายความยาวได้ถึงประมาณ 1 เมตร
สามารถเชื่อมต่อจอแสดงผล LED แบบ 7-segment เข้ากับบอร์ดไดรเวอร์ได้กี่ตัว?
สามารถเชื่อมต่อจอแสดงผล LED ได้สูงสุด 4 จอเข้ากับบอร์ดขับสัญญาณ
แรงดันไฟฟ้าขาเข้ามีความสัมพันธ์กับความสว่างหรือไม่
ยิ่งแรงดันไฟฟ้าสูง ความสว่างก็จะยิ่งมากขึ้น แต่แรงดันและกระแสไฟฟ้าที่สูงเกินกำหนดจะทำให้จอแสดงผล LED เสียหายได้ ควรใช้ตัวต้านทานจำกัดกระแสไฟฟ้าจากภายนอก
ส่วนเชื่อมต่อสามารถลอดผ่านรูที่ฝาปิดปลายได้หรือไม่
ดัดงอเล็กน้อยเพื่อให้สอดผ่านรูขนาด Ø10.1 ± 0.1 มม. ได้
มีบอร์ดไดรเวอร์ภายในหรือไม่
ไม่ครับ ภายในมีเพียงสายสัญญาณ 8 เส้นที่ต่อตรงไปยังจอแสดงผล LED เท่านั้น จึงจำเป็นต้องใช้บอร์ดไดรเวอร์ภายนอก